
给人工智能标注数据的主要方法包括:手动标注、半自动化标注、自动化标注。 其中,手动标注是最常见且最基础的方法,虽然耗时,但能确保高质量的数据。手动标注的核心在于人类标注员根据预设的标签体系,逐个检查和标记数据。手动标注的最大优势是高准确性和灵活性,适用于复杂的数据集。
一、人工智能标注的基本概念
什么是数据标注?
数据标注是指为训练人工智能模型而对数据进行标记的过程。标注的数据可以包括文本、图像、音频和视频等各种形式。通过数据标注,机器学习模型能够识别和理解数据中的特定模式,从而提高其性能和准确性。
数据标注的重要性
数据标注是人工智能和机器学习的核心环节。高质量的标注数据是训练有效模型的基础。 没有准确的标注,模型无法学习到正确的特征,性能会大打折扣。此外,高质量的标注数据还能帮助模型在实际应用中更加稳健和可靠。
二、手动标注
手动标注的流程
- 数据收集:首先,需要收集大量的原始数据,这些数据可以是文本、图像、视频等。
- 定义标签体系:根据具体任务,定义一个明确的标签体系。例如,进行情感分析时,标签可能包括“正面”、“中性”、“负面”。
- 标注工具选择:选择合适的数据标注工具,这些工具可以简化标注过程,提高效率。
- 标注任务分配:将数据分配给标注员,确保每个标注员都能理解任务要求和标签定义。
- 质量控制:通过交叉验证、复审等方法,确保标注质量。
手动标注的优势和挑战
优势:
- 高准确性:人类标注员能够理解复杂的上下文和细节,确保标注的准确性。
- 灵活性:手动标注可以适应不同类型和复杂度的数据。
挑战:
- 耗时费力:手动标注需要大量的人力和时间,特别是对于大型数据集。
- 一致性问题:不同的标注员可能会有不同的理解,导致标注结果不一致。
三、半自动化标注
半自动化标注的概念
半自动化标注是指结合人工和自动化工具的标注方法。自动化工具可以在初期阶段标注数据,然后由人类标注员进行审核和修正。这种方法可以在保证标注质量的同时,提高效率。
半自动化标注的实现方法
- 预训练模型:利用已有的预训练模型对数据进行初步标注。
- 人工审核:人类标注员对自动标注结果进行审核和修正,确保准确性。
- 反馈循环:将修正后的数据反馈给模型,进一步提高自动标注的准确性。
半自动化标注的优势和挑战
优势:
- 效率高:自动化工具可以显著提高标注速度。
- 成本低:减少了对人力的需求,降低了标注成本。
挑战:
- 初期投入:需要投入时间和资源训练初始模型。
- 审核负担:自动化标注结果的准确性不高时,人工审核的工作量依然较大。
四、自动化标注
自动化标注的概念
自动化标注是指完全依赖机器学习模型对数据进行标注的过程。这通常需要一个高度训练的模型,能够在大多数情况下提供准确的标注结果。
实现自动化标注的方法
- 训练高质量模型:需要大量高质量的训练数据来训练模型,使其能够准确标注新的数据。
- 模型更新:定期更新和优化模型,以适应新数据和新任务的需求。
- 自动化工具:利用各种自动化工具和平台,简化标注流程。
自动化标注的优势和挑战
优势:
- 速度快:自动化标注几乎可以即时完成大规模数据的标注。
- 可扩展性强:适用于大规模数据集,能够轻松扩展。
挑战:
- 准确性问题:模型的准确性直接影响标注结果,可能需要大量的初始训练数据。
- 模型偏差:模型可能会存在偏差,导致标注结果不准确或有偏见。
五、标注工具和平台
常用的数据标注工具
- Labelbox:提供全面的数据标注解决方案,支持多种数据类型。
- Supervise.ly:提供图像和视频标注功能,支持团队协作。
- Amazon SageMaker Ground Truth:提供半自动化标注功能,结合机器学习模型提高效率。
选择标注工具的考虑因素
- 数据类型支持:确保工具支持所需的数据类型(文本、图像、音频等)。
- 团队协作:支持团队协作和任务分配,提高标注效率。
- 质量控制:提供质量控制功能,如复审和交叉验证,确保标注质量。
六、标注项目管理
项目规划
- 明确任务目标:定义清晰的标注目标和标准,确保所有参与者理解一致。
- 任务分配:根据标注员的能力和经验,合理分配标注任务。
- 时间管理:制定合理的时间表,确保项目按时完成。
质量控制
- 多层次审核:通过多层次审核机制,如初审、复审,确保标注结果的准确性。
- 一致性检查:定期检查标注结果的一致性,及时发现和纠正问题。
- 反馈机制:建立反馈机制,及时收集标注员的反馈,持续改进标注流程。
七、标注数据的应用
训练机器学习模型
高质量的标注数据是训练机器学习模型的关键。 有了准确的标注数据,模型能够更好地学习和理解特征,提高性能和准确性。
数据分析和挖掘
标注数据不仅用于训练模型,还可以用于数据分析和挖掘。例如,通过分析标注数据,可以发现数据中的隐藏模式和趋势,辅助决策和优化。
质量评估
标注数据还可以用于模型的质量评估。通过对比模型预测结果和标注数据,可以评估模型的性能,并找到改进的方向。
八、未来的发展趋势
智能标注
随着人工智能技术的发展,智能标注将成为未来的趋势。 智能标注结合了人工智能和人类智慧,能够在提高效率的同时,保证标注质量。
自适应标注
自适应标注是指根据数据和任务的特点,动态调整标注策略和方法。这种方法能够更好地适应不同的数据和任务,提高标注效果。
标注平台的发展
未来,标注平台将更加智能化和自动化,提供更全面的解决方案。例如,结合自然语言处理、计算机视觉等技术,提供更加智能的标注工具和平台。
综上所述,数据标注是人工智能和机器学习不可或缺的一环。无论是手动标注、半自动化标注还是自动化标注,每种方法都有其独特的优势和挑战。通过合理选择和组合不同的标注方法,结合高效的标注工具和平台,可以大幅提高标注效率和质量,从而推动人工智能技术的发展和应用。
相关问答FAQs:
1. 人工智能标注的目的是什么?
人工智能标注的目的是为了让机器能够理解和识别图像、文本、语音等数据,并进行相应的处理和分析。
2. 人工智能标注有哪些常见的方法和技术?
人工智能标注的常见方法和技术包括:图像标注(如物体检测、语义分割、关键点标注等)、文本标注(如命名实体识别、情感分析、关系抽取等)、语音标注(如语音识别、语音合成等)等。
3. 如何进行高质量的人工智能标注?
要进行高质量的人工智能标注,首先需要有一批经过专业培训的标注人员,他们需要具备相关领域的知识和技能。其次,需要制定明确的标注规范和标准,确保标注结果的准确性和一致性。同时,还可以借助自动化工具和算法,提高标注效率和质量。
4. 人工智能标注的应用领域有哪些?
人工智能标注在许多领域都有广泛的应用,包括计算机视觉、自然语言处理、语音识别等。在计算机视觉领域,人工智能标注可以用于图像识别、智能驾驶、医学影像分析等;在自然语言处理领域,人工智能标注可以用于机器翻译、智能客服、文本分类等;在语音识别领域,人工智能标注可以用于语音助手、智能音箱等。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/132342